I drink the isopure drinks. (not the powdered shake) they actually sell a protein drink in glass bottles that taste like Kool aid with a little after taste. They are 40 Grams of Protein and NO CARBS. I usually drink that through out the day instead of water and its gets me the extra kick I need. Grape Frost and Icy orange are my favorite but they have about 6 out there. I have found them at GNC and Vitamin Shoppe

Hi, For me I make sugar free puddings with skin milk and mix in protein powder vanilla for vanilla or butterscotch flavors chocolate with chocolate. I also use urjury's chicken soup flavor powder in strained chicken noodle soup (just be sure you do not heat it over 130 degrees). I also use torani sugar free syrups strawberry or vanilla in non fat plain Greek yogurt to help sweeten it up.
